"Engaged Citizenry," at the Unitarian Universalist Fellowship of Silver City
Sunday, February 05, 2023, 10:00am |
Lynda Aiman-Smith will discuss how civic engagement entails individual and collective actions designed to identify and address issues of concern to the local community, or the greater public.
“Civic engagement can take many forms, from individual voluntarism to organizational work,” she said.
Aiman-Smith will talk about the various ways that people can learn how to be active citizens and identify potential ways to engage that may be new and exciting. Drawing from current published data, She will also discuss what we know about current civic engagement in various groups.
Lynda Aiman-Smith is a multi-generational New Mexican. Before retiring to Silver City she was a tenured faculty member at the Poole College of Management at North Carolina State University. She has been an active citizen in a number of non-profits and served for eight years as a Silver City Town Councilor.
